Understanding Untraceable Guns

The issue of so-called "ghost" guns, often described as untraceable firearms, presents a significant challenge for law enforcement and national safety. These firearms are typically assembled from independently purchased components, often through online retailers, making it more difficult to monitor their production and stop their use in illegal activities. Compared to traditionally manufactured firearms, which have serial numbers and undergo background checks, these components can be obtained with minimal oversight. This lack of tracking makes it extremely hard to locate individuals using these weapons, and creates serious questions about responsibility. The ongoing debate revolves around strengthening existing regulations and implementing additional measures to resolve this emerging problem, all while protecting the rights of responsible gun owners.
